Rosehip oil is an amazing skincare product made of rosehips. Rosehips are basically fruits that grow on the rosebush after roses die. The fruit is small and has a reddish-orange color. Rosehip oil is made from that fruit. If you associate the name of the oil with a floral note, you are not alone.

Knowing that it comes from a rosebush and that it’s a fruit, you would think that the rosehip oil smell is floral or fruity. But it actually doesn’t. It usually does not have a strong scent and it is usually very earthy and natural. So, the smell of rosehip oil actually has absolutely nothing to do with roses and flowers!

What Rosehip Oil Should and Shouldn’t Smell Like

Most people agree that rosehip oil smells natural and earthy and has no connection to floral or fruity notes. Some say that it smells a bit like tea when it gets cold and others say that it smells like hay or autumn leaves or even like wood.

As long as the smell is pleasant or neutral for the most part, then you shouldn’t worry at all. All things considered, rosehip oil does not have a strong scent. But what if it doesn’t?

Your rosehip oil should never smell sour or rancid. If it smells like spoiled milk or something similar, throw it away.

What Is Rosehip Oil?

We can safely say that rosehip oil is ancient medicine. It dates all the way back to the ancient Egyptians, having been used by the likes of Cleopatra. Rosehip oil contains vitamin A, vitamin C, vitamin F, and several fatty acids:

  • palmitic acid
  • linoleic acid
  • oleic acid
  • gamma-linolenic acid

This makes rosehip oil a potent skincare product that will leave your skin hydrated, nourished, and healthy. It is also full of antioxidants that are a great way to slow down the aging process.

Benefits of Rosehip Oil

Thanks to all the antioxidants, fatty acids, and vitamins, rosehip oil can work wonders for your skin. It can even reverse the damage done to your skin from scars or the sun.

Thanks to the fatty acids found in rosehip oil, it can soothe irritations and redness. You can use it for acne as well to make it go away quicker. Even if you have very sensitive skin, rosehip oil will have a calming and nourishing effect, leaving your skin hydrated without making it greasy or oily.

You can also use the amazing oil on your scalp and hair. Just like many other essential oils, it will nourish your hair and make it shiny, strong, and gorgeous. It is best to apply rosehip oil an hour or two before washing your hair. Make sure that you massage it into your scalp for the best results.

And since nails are made of keratin, just like your hair, you can use it to make your brittle nails stronger. You can use the oil on both your nails and hands and it will leave your hands smooth, moisturized, and healthy.

And last but not least, you can use rosehip oil as a makeup remover. Instead of using makeup wipes that are not very good for your skin, use the soothing rosehip oil to remove your eye makeup. No wrinkles and no makeup at the same time? Why not!
